Google AI Badge

Google AI Badge

The Google AI badge is awarded to members who publish high quality posts about Google AI technology. We award this badge periodically and it's not an easy achievement! If you don't get it the first time, don't be discouraged. All posts about Google AI technology are considered (think Gemini, Antigravity, Google AI Studio, etc).

Google Cloud Run Badge

Google Cloud Run Badge

The Google Cloud Run Badge is awarded to anyone who includes a Cloud Run embed in their DEV post for the first time.

How to Embed Cloud Run

You can embed your Cloud Run deployment directly in your DEV post by using our embed syntax with your Cloud Run URL:

{% embed your_cloud_run_url %}
